August 12th is celebrated as National Librarian’s Day in India, in remembrance of national professor of library science, Dr. S R Ranganathan, who had spearheaded library development in India.
Born on 9th / 12th August 1892 Siyali Ramamrita Ranganathan or S. R. Ranganathan was a mathematician by profession. His lifelong goal was to teach mathematics. However, when the post of University Librarian opened up in the University of Madras, he applied for it and was appointed eventually. This was a turning phase of his career.
His most notable contributions to the field were his five laws of library science and the development of the first major faceted classification system, the colon classification. He is considered to be the father of library science, documentation, and information science in India.
His birthday is celebrated in India as National Librarians' Day every year. In his remembrance, India Post has issued a one rupee stamp depicting the bust of Dr, Ranganathan in an oval frame with the University of Madras at the background.
